## pg_reshard_chunk_size
|
||||
|
||||
- Type: integer
|
||||
- Default: 100000
|
||||
|
||||
Pool PG count change is a CPU-intensive operation because OSDs store the full object database
|
||||
in memory and have to move all entries between old and new PGs. Thus it's performed in chunks,
|
||||
with pauses between chunks to prevent blocking OSD's event loop and other clients' operations.
|
||||
This option sets the maximum number of object is a chunk. Moving 100k objects usually takes
|
||||
50-100ms. Chunk size equal to 0 means unlimited.
|
||||
|
||||
## pg_reshard_chunk_pause_ms
|
||||
|
||||
- Type: milliseconds
|
||||
- Default: 100
|
||||
|
||||
This option sets the interval between handling two PG count change chunks.
